UNITED STATES
                       SECURITIES AND EXCHANGE COMMISSION
                            Washington, D.C.  20549

                                    Form 13F

                              Form 13F COVER PAGE

Report for the Calendar Year or Quarter Ended: March 31, 2005

Check here if Amendment [  ]; Amendment Number:
This Amendment (Check only one.): [ X ] is a restatement.
                                  [   ] adds new holdings entries.

Institutional Investment Manager Filing this Report:

Name:    Greenleaf Trust
Address: 100 West Michigan Avenue, Suite 100
         Kalamazoo, Michigan  49007

13F File Number:  28-10142

The institutional investment manager filing this report and the person by whom
it is signed hereby represent that the person signing the report is authorized
to submit it, that all information contained herein is true, correct and
complete, and that it is understood that all required items, statements,
schedules, lists, and tables, are considered integral parts of this form.

Person Signing this Report on Behalf of Reporting Manager:

Name:      William D. Johnston
Title:     President
Phone:     269-388-9800

Signature, Place, and Date of Signing:

     William D. Johnston     Kalamazoo, MI     May 16, 2005


Report Type (Check only one.):

[ X]         13F HOLDINGS REPORT.

[  ]         13F NOTICE.

[  ]         13F COMBINATION REPORT.





<PAGE>

                              FORM 13F SUMMARY PAGE


Report Summary:

Number of Other Included Managers:          0

Form 13F Information Table Entry Total:     76

Form 13F Information Table Value Total:     $310,170,451 (thousands)


List of Other Included Managers:

Provide a numbered list of the name(s) and Form 13F file number(s) of all
institutional managers with respect to which this report is filed, other
than the manager filing this report.

NONE


<PAGE>



<TABLE>                       <C>             <C>
                                                     FORM 13F INFORMATION TABLE
                                                             VALUE  SHARES/ SH/ PUT/ INVSTMT  OTHER            VOTING AUTHORITY
NAME OF ISSUER                 TITLE OF CLASS   CUSIP     (x$1000)  PRN AMT PRN CALL DSCRETN MANAGERS         SOLE   SHARED     NONE
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
AFLAC Inc			COM	001055102	4772783	128094	sh		shared	0	101144	0	26950
Affiliated Computer Services	CL A	008190100	6384168	119913	sh		shared	0	94968	0	24945
Alberto Culver Co		COM	013068101	5826620	121743	sh		shared	0	97673	0	24070
Amgen Inc			COM	031162100	477963	8211	sh		shared	0	6280	0	1931
Amphenol Corp NEW		CL A	032095101	6187791	167057	sh		shared	0	135047	0	32010
Automatic Data Processing	COM	053015103	224750	5000	sh		shared	0	2050	0	2950
BP PLC			Sponsored ADR	055622104	288163	4618	sh		sole	0	4618	0	0
Bank of America			COM	060505104	6056077	137326	sh		shared	0	113076	0	24250
Bed Bath Beyond Inc		COM	075896100	5745184	157230	sh		sole	0	128350	0	28880
Berkshire Hathaway Inc Del	CL A	084670108	6699000	77	sh		sole	0	77	0	0
Best Buy Inc			COM	086516101	5737213	106225	sh		shared	0	85540	0	20685
Bright Horizon Family Solutions	COM	109195107	2746976	81416	sh		shared	0	64176	0	17240
CDW Corporation			COM	12512N105	4478287	79010	sh		shared	0	63090	0	15920
Carrington Labs Inc		COM	144525102	113520	22000	sh		sole	0	22000	0	0
Cheesecake Factory Inc		COM	163072101	4757106	134192	sh		shared	0	108002	0	26190
Chemical Fincl Corp		COM	163731102	213915	6581	sh		shared	0	6581	0	0
Chico's Fas			COM	168615102	5423772	191924	sh		shared	0	155830	0	36094
Cisco Sys Inc			COM	17275R102	517683	28937	sh		sole	0	22715	0	6222
Citigroup Inc			COM	172967101	6744011	150067	sh		shared	0	116711	0	33356
Dell Inc			CL B	24702R101	6381677	166103	sh		shared	0	135383	0	30720
Dionex Corp			COM	254546104	2057921	37760	sh		shared	0	31185	0	6575
Dow Chem Co			COM	260543103	234046	4695	sh		sole	0	4695	0	0
Electronic Arts Inc		COM	285512109	3953352	76349	sh		shared	0	59104	0	17245
Enerplus Res Fd		Unit TR G NEW	29274D604	2569021	70850	sh		shared	0	56595	0	14255
Exxon Mobil Corp		COM	30231G102	1171438	19655	sh		shared	0	19055	0	600
Factset Resh Sys Inc		COM	303075105	2513679	76149	sh		shared	0	59699	0	16450
Fastenal Co			COM	311900104	5874353	106227	sh		shared	0	83150	0	23077
Fifth Third Bancorp		COM	316773100	1507996	35086	sh		shared	0	26058	0	9028
First National Lincoln Corp	COM	335716106	239700	14100	sh		sole	0	0	0	14100
Flaherty & Crmn/Clymr Pfd Se	COM SHS	338478100	975302	43893	sh		sole	0	42714	0	1179
Flaherty & Crumrine Pfd Inc	COM	33848E106	1017710	85450	sh		shared	0	70175	0	15275
Fortune Brands Inc	  CL B CONV	349631101	6002501	74445	sh		shared	0	59125	0	15320
General Electric Co		COM	369604103	1115011	30921	sh		shared	0	22822	0	8099
Gentex Corp			COM	371901109	229680	7200	sh		shared	0	1150	0	6050
Harley Davidson Inc		COM	412822108	4215614	72985	sh		shared	0	58885	0	14100
Huntington Bancshares Inc	COM	446150104	203676	8522	sh		sole	0	8522	0	0
Intel Corp			COM	458140100	324523	13970	sh		shared	0	7845	0	6125
IBM Corp			COM	459200101	221597	2425	sh		shared	0	2425	0	0
ISHARES TR		S&P500/BAR GRW	464287309	474148	8392	sh		sole	0	7117	0	1275
ISHARES TR		S&P500/BAR VAL	464287408	2859896	46922	sh		sole	0	42832	0	4090
ISHARES TR		S&P Midcp Grow	464287606	411433	3072	sh		sole	0	2857	0	215
ISHARES TR		S&P SMLCP VALU	464287879	1636126	13869	sh		sole	0	13190	0	679
ISHARES TR		S&P SMLCP GROW	464287887	1589521	15088	sh		sole	0	13547	0	1541
JPMorgan & Chase & CO		COM	46625H100	745007	21532	sh		shared	0	12071	0	9461
Johnson & Johnson		COM	478160104	647221	9637	sh		shared	0	8037	0	1600
Kronos Inc			COM	501052104	4748631	92910	sh		shared	0	73400	0	19510
L-3 Communications Hldg Corp	COM	502424104	5261517	74085	sh		shared	0	58580	0	15505
La Jolla Pharmaceutical Co	COM	503459109	12145	17350	sh		sole	0	17350	0	0
Landstar Systems Inc		COM	515098101	1973515	60260	sh		shared	0	49660	0	10600
MBNA Corp			COM	55262L100	6064734	247036	sh		shared	0	196035	0	51001
McGraw Hill Cos Inc		CL A	580645109	2614882	29970	sh		shared	0	23120	0	6850
Medtronic Inc			COM	585055106	376215	7384	sh		shared	0	7384	0	0
Microsoft Corp			COM	594918104	237688	9834	sh		shared	0	8500	0	1334
MIDCAP SPDR TR		UNIT SER 1	595635103	2440147	20267	sh		sole	0	17654	0	2613
Morgan Stanley Emer Mkts Fd	COM	61744G107	6020477	347402	sh		shared	0	285663	0	61739
National City Corp		COM	635405103	1078399	32191	sh		shared	0	27648	0	4543
O Reilly Automotive Inc		COM	686091109	6829939	137895	sh		shared	0	107110	0	30785
Patterson Companies Inc		COM	703395103	202298	4050	sh		shared	0	0	0	4050
Pepsico Inc			COM	713448108	445982	8410	sh		shared	0	3417	0	4993
Pfizer Inc			COM	717081103	23259905	885417	sh		shared	0	539733	0	345684
Polaris Industries		COM	731068102	4082329	58128	sh		shared	0	44332	0	13796
Rare Hospitality Intl Inc	COM	753820109	2565665	83085	sh		shared	0	66985	0	16100
Respironics Inc			COM	761230101	4807858	82510	sh		shared	0	64825	0	17685
Rural/Metro Corp		COM	781748108	163990	31000	sh		shared	0	31000	0	0
SFBC Intl Inc			COM	784121105	2439137	69215	sh		shared	0	55295	0	13920
SPDR TR			UNIT SER 1	78462F103	1296499	10991	sh		sole	0	10359	0	632
Sara Lee Corp			COM	803111103	291404	13150	sh		sole	0	13150	0	0
Shuffle Master Inc		COM	825549108	2248831	77653	sh		shared	0	61247	0	16406
Stryker Corp			COM	863667101	89531244	2006977	sh		shared	0	804929	0	1202048
Suncore Energy			COM	867229106	2330371	57955	sh		shared	0	48005	0	9950
Sun Trust Banks			COM	867914103	262335	3640	sh		shared	0	2057	0	1583
Symantec Corp			COM	871503108	4624344	216800	sh		shared	0	171505	0	45295
Sysco Corp			COM	871829107	6138268	171460	sh		shared	0	139460	0	32000
3M Company			COM	88579Y101	250300	2921	sh		shared	0	2921	0	0
Viacom Inc			CL B	925524308	2044173	58690	sh		shared	0	48715	0	9975
Walgreen Co			COM	931422109	2960104	66639	sh		shared	0	48364	0	18275



</TABLE>